Output 58926c064bb69d278f48eb1d084fe24edc219f7253fe46cc4911395494c14639:0

value
991379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c817318f93d0ab28c715fa204632eedd667dbed OP_EQUALVERIFY OP_CHECKSIG
address
1DovgAz4bd3jLyHuvwY1mjWJegczS5uKh7
transaction
58926c064bb69d278f48eb1d084fe24edc219f7253fe46cc4911395494c14639
spent
true